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Montrose to Dalmuir start from as little as £26.70

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Montrose to Dalmuir are available for £55.00 one way, or £89.80 return

Facilities and Amenities

Montrose station is well-equipped to cater to travelers. The staffed ticket office operates from 06:20 to 19:30 on weekdays and from 09:10 to 16:30 on Sundays, ensuring that ticket purchasing and collection are convenient. Furthermore, there's accessibility in mind with features such as step-free access across the entire station, accessible ticket machines, and a hearing induction loop. However, travelers should be aware that there are no accessible toilets available, and refreshment facilities are absent on-site, so it's best to plan ahead if you'll need these amenities during your visit.

For those keen on cycling, Montrose offers 10 bicycle storage spaces — although those planning to rent a bike will need to look elsewhere. Car parking facilities are ample, boasting 50 spaces, of which six are reserved for blue badge holders. Parking is available 24 hours a day, free of charge, further adding to the station’s convenience.

Transport Links

Montrose train station provides multiple options for onward travel, ensuring seamless connectivity for all travelers. Bus and taxi services are readily accessible, with buses picking up and dropping off from the station car park on Western Road. For detailed bus services, you can visit the Traveline Scotland website or dial their 24-hour helpline. For taxi availability, the TrainTaxi website is a helpful resource. During periodic rail service disruptions, buses serve as replacement transport, ensuring your journey continues smoothly.

Facilities and Amenities

Dalmuir Train Station is well-equipped with modern amenities designed to cater to both seasoned travelers and occasional train users. Ticket purchasing is hassle-free with a ticket office open from 05:45 to midnight on weekdays and open from 08:10 to midnight on Sundays. For added convenience, ticket machines are available along with accessible versions for ease of use. There's no need to fret about collecting tickets bought online, as pick-up at ticket machines is straightforward and efficient.

While waiting for your train, you can relax in the comfortable seating areas or use the accessible toilets available on-site. Although there's no dedicated first-class lounge, the waiting room promises comfort. For cycling enthusiasts, the station offers bike racks with CCTV protection, ensuring your ride is safely stored during your travels.

Accessibility and Support

Accessibility is a priority at Dalmuir Station. It boasts step-free access, ensuring easy navigation through the station's grounds. There are four accessible parking spaces as well as an impaired mobility pick-up and set-down point, making the station welcoming for those with mobility challenges. With induction loops, ramps for train access, and a Passenger Assist service for travelers requiring special assistance, the station emphasizes a worry-free journey for everyone.

Transport Links from Dalmuir

Getting to and from Dalmuir Train Station is a breeze thanks to the diverse transport links available. Local buses provide convenient connections with bus pick-ups and drop-offs located just outside Park Rd at the scout hall. For precise pick-up locations, you can verify through what3words. Alternatively, taxis are readily available, with details accessible on traintaxi.co.uk. Travelers desiring more information about bus services can head to Travelinescotland.
